Vikings Extend Theo Jackson's Contract Through 2027
The Minnesota Vikings have secured safety Theo Jackson with a two-year contract extension worth $12.615 million, as reported by multiple sources including ESPN and NFL Network. Jackson, initially a sixth-round pick by the Tennessee Titans in 2022, has been a key special teams player but is now positioned for a larger role, given the uncertain futures of starting safeties Harrison Smith and Cam Bynum, who are both potential free agents. Smith is contemplating retirement with a hefty contract looming, while Bynum might explore free agency next week. Jackson's extension reflects the Vikings' confidence in his capabilities, following his impressive training camp performances and contributions in 43 career games, where he recorded two interceptions and 47 tackles. This strategic move aims to stabilize the Vikings' safety lineup amidst anticipated changes in their defensive backfield.
